Financial History
| Year | Revenue | Expenses | Assets |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2023 | $1,978,424 | $991,383 | $2,795,639 |
| 2022 | $1,335,903 | $1,082,110 | $1,808,598 |
| 2021 | $1,573,983 | $916,729 | $1,554,805 |
| 2020 | $1,019,600 | $910,063 | $862,301 |
| 2014 | $636,196 | $556,957 | $462,556 |
| 2013 | $500,395 | $510,564 | $383,317 |
| 2012 | $558,151 | $557,661 | $393,486 |
| 2011 | $621,747 | $571,836 | $408,328 |
